Marco Rubio called on Thursday for the Department of Defense to take over short term relief and recovery effortsWashington (CNN) The Pentagon has appointed Lt. Gen. Jeffrey Buchanan to lead all military hurricane efforts in Puerto Rico, according to multiple US Defense officials. A three-star star general and the Commander of US Army North (5th Army), Buchanan is expected to arrive in Puerto Rico Thursday as the military will focus on trying to improve distribution networks of relief supplies. Puerto Rico's devastated infrastructure and a shortage of truck drivers is making it difficult to move aid where it is needed most -- evident by the more than 9,500 containers of relief supplies currently stranded on Puerto Rico's main port of San Juan.
